RINA is currently recruiting for a Sustainability Project Manager to join its office in Genova, Roma, Napoli, or Milano, Italy, within the Cyber Security and Management Consulting Division. Mission The Project Manager in this role takes on a leadership position, contributing strategic insights and overseeing the successful execution of projects, ensuring completion of deliverables within the defined deadlines, scope, and budget. It is a pivotal role in client relationships, team development, and the implementation of impactful solutions in the field of sustainability, providing strategic consultancy activities across sectors such as manufacturing, O&G, energy, and public entities. Key Accountabilities Manage projects for industrial customers, ensuring deliverables are completed within deadlines, scope, and budget. Manage customer relationships and identify business opportunities. Coordinate the preparation of techno-economic proposals. Oversee sustainability-related projects: assist clients in measuring impacts, conduct ESG assessments, support decarbonization strategies, and help clients report ESG performance in compliance with regulations and standards. Stay informed on emerging sustainability trends and monitor developments based on legislation and certifications. Qualifications At least 2 years of experience in the sustainability field. Ability to handle multiple tasks and work under tight deadlines. Fluency in English and Italian. Nice to Have Knowledge of sustainability topics and instruments such as LCA, GHG accounting, CSRD, CSDDD, EU Taxonomy. Knowledge of project management principles including scheduling, budgeting, and resource planning. Education Master’s Degree in Economics or Engineering. With over 5,800 employees and 200 offices in 70 countries, RINA provides certification, marine classification, testing, supervision, inspection, training, and engineering consultancy services across sectors. Our goal is to ensure the technical, environmental, safety, and economic sustainability of projects from concept to completion.
